Haryana’s rise as an investment destination is nothing short of spectacular, with exports soaring and MSMEs mushrooming across the State. In the textile and apparel sector, Haryana’s prowess shines through, with a significant contribution to India’s exports. With over 35 per cent of carpets and 20 per cent of garments manufactured in the State, Haryana is cementing its position as a textile powerhouse. The strategic alignment with national initiatives like the PM Gati Shakti Yojana and the establishment of industrial parks exemplify Haryana’s proactive approach towards economic prosperity. The State’s healthcare infrastructure has received a significant boost, with the establishment of medical universities and skill development centres catering to the evolving needs of the populace.

The number of medical colleges has surged from 6 in 2014 to 15 and the number of MBBS seats has increased from 700 to 2185. Moreover, the number of PG seats in medical colleges has grown from 289 to 1006.

The State has further enhanced nutritional outcomes for children, adolescents, pregnant women and lactating mothers through the POSHAN Abhiyan.

In agriculture, schemes like PM-KISAN and PM Fasal Bima Yojana have provided a safety net for farmers, ensuring their livelihood security. Today, PM-KISAN has benefited over 20 lakh farmers in the State with assistance of over Rs. 5,000 crore. Haryana plays a pivotal role in India’s journey towards becoming a global nutrition hub. There are ambitious plans that include promoting the State’s coarse grains like jowar and millet on the international stage, the implementation of the world’s largest warehouse project and the creation of specialised clusters over the next 5 years. Also, there are plans for a revolutionary drone initiative in farming, empowering mothers and sisters with drone pilot training to harness the latest technology in agriculture.

Cultural preservation and promotion have been integral to Haryana’s development narrative, with initiatives like the PM Vishwakarma Yojana fostering artisanal traditions and ‘Ek Bharat Shreshtha Bharat’ fostering cultural exchange. The State’s rich heritage is being showcased through initiatives like the Anubhav Kendra Jyotisar and the development of archaeological sites like Rakhi Garhi.
